The same day that Volkswagen AG reported that the diesel emissions scandal that has cost it $18.2 billion so far, Mercedes Benz parent company Daimler said today that it is launching an internal investigation into the emissions certification process for its diesel vehicles. That news, plus a shortfall on first quarter earnings expectations, sent shares 5.5% lower.

Daimler said the diesel probe stems from communications it has had with the U.S. Dept. of Justice. This action also follows the filing of a lawsuit by a U.S.-based Mercedes vehicle owner charging the German automaker with allegedly using a device to affect its emissions tests.

The suit, filed by Seattle, Washington-based law firm Hagens Berman Sobol Shaprio, LLP, says the action is based, in part, on an article published in German magazine Der Spiegel, which claims that Mercedes admitted to designing the diesel-powered vehicles to shut off emissions controls in cooler ambient temperatures to protect the engine. Daimler has begun production of its 9G-TRONIC nine-speed automatic transmission at its Sebes factory in Romania. The production is being handled by its Romanian subsidiary Star Assembly.

The German luxury car-maker has invested about €300m to expand the production capacity at the facility and creating 1000 new jobs in the process. The facility will spread across area roughly ten times that of a football pitch.

The production at Seres facility was officially inaugurated by Romanian Vice Prime Minister and Minister of Economy, Costin Borc and Mercedes-Benz Cars member of the Divisional Board Markus Schäfer and other members. Continue Reading

ENFIELD, CT – A Massachusetts man accused of stealing rims from a car in the southern end of Enfield was arrested early Thursday morning after engaging police in a pursuit on Interstate 91.

Jonathan Beltran, 26, of Holyoke, is charged with third-degree larceny, sixth-degree larceny, interfering with an officer, reckless driving, engaging police in pursuit and operating without a license.

He was held on $15,000 bond, and was scheduled to be arraigned Friday in Enfield Superior Court. Continue Reading

April 19 (Reuters) – Formula One should shelve plans for major rule changes in 2017 because the sport is in an ‘ideal situation’ already with faster cars and more competitive races, according to Mercedes motorsport head Toto Wolff.

The Austrian, whose team have dominated since the 1.6 litre V6 turbo hybrid power units were introduced in 2014, said there was an argument for doing nothing after three exciting races this season.

Formula One teams have until the end of April to agree 2017 rule changes by majority vote and meetings are scheduled in the coming days as the sport seeks to make cars faster and more spectacular. Continue Reading

Volkswagen has struck a deal with the US government over the diesel-emissions-cheating scandal that has plagued the car maker.

Under the terms of the agreement, Volkswagen would include ‘substantial compensation’ to owners of VW’s diesel vehicles, and would establish an environmental compensation fund.

U.S. Judge Charles Breyer said the settlement is expected to include a buyback offer for nearly 500,000 2.0-liter vehicles and a possible fix if regulators agree on it. The settlement will include an environmental remediation fund and additional compensation to owners to sell back or have vehicles fixed. Continue Reading
